moje zkusenost je takova ze php na windows proste ne-e. ani zadarmo. zkus zavolat url /ščřžýšřčěšžč-čřž . 64bit php driver pro mssql neni. kdyz chces nahodit jakoukoliv extension tak aby ses podelal pri googleni te spravne verze nebo shanel bambilion nastroju ke zkompilovani... a je to ukrutne pomale.Kdyz uz nekdo jde do php tak proboha proc to komplikovat (pro git plati to same). bohuzel stale existuje hodne exotu kteri pisou php ve widlich a tlaci to pres ftp.
Proč bych měl přistupovat k produkčnímu serveru jinak, než jednoduchým příkazem deployovacího nástroje, když produkční prostředí není třeba upgradovat a nemá jiný SW problém?
Proč bych měl přistupovat k čemukoli přes FTP? Kolikrát se v článku opakuje to archaické "FTP"?
Tohle je tak moc, že po prvním/druhém odstavci se dá jen mlátit hlavou do stolu.
Taky nechápu, asi na Windows dosud neobjevili nic lepšího. Jsem rád, že s tím jejich světem už nemám dlouho nic společného :-)
A co se týče toho Gitu, přijde mi to taky trochu zvrácené. IMHO verzovací systém na produkční stroj nepatří – tam se mají nasazovat hotové balíčky, ne tam laborovat s „repozitářem“.
Zajimave, ze na Lupe je podobny clanek od stejneho autora oznaceny jako "Komercni sdeleni": http://www.lupa.cz/pr-clanky/jak-jsme-programovali-pro-tisice-uzivatelu-bez-vlastni-infrastruktury/
Nějak mi asi uniká podstata psaní protokolu https a portu 443
(https://veproza@test-root.scm.azurewebsites.net:443/test-root.git)
Má to nějaký důvod psát obojí pokud port https je cílového serveru je default 443? :-)
Skončil jsem jinak u phpinfo kde jsem si přečetl CGI/FastCGI - jako v pohodě, používám taky fcgid, ale pochybuju, že to na těch widlích bude nějak konfigurovatelné, jako třeba MaxProcesses atp... a pak vidím C:\Windows\...
wtf? Ne nadarmo se web servery provozují na linuxu z větší části - funguje to prostě :-)
U PHP mi trochu vadí výchozí konfigurace, se kterou si očividně nedali žádnou práci, i když si můžeme nastavení změnit, ale proč? Člověk co si tohle objedná je stejně trotl a ani třeba neví jak to nastavit. Chce jednoduše uploadnout co má, spustit webový install.php jak to tak bývá a projít průvodce svého možná nového shopu.
kolik lidi potrebuje skalovat... pokud by mi opravdu stacil prachobycejny git na php hostingu tak jsem mel moznost na jednom projektu pouzit tento hosting: http://blog.blueboard.cz/git/ a splnilo presne to co jsem cekal - moznost vypnuti FTP :-)
Tych PAAS na PHP nie je az tak malo. V SR existuje www.iserver.sk, mam tam asi 50 domen.
Doporučuji používat službu Cloudways PHP MySQL hosting, pokud chcete pomocí jednoho kliknutí měnit velikost a nasazení git. Tuto platformu můžete použít k spuštění serveru založeného na PHP jedním kliknutím, aniž byste museli ručně instalovat zásobník. Kdykoli chcete měnit váš server, můžete to udělat i jedním kliknutím. Nasazení Git je také jedním kliknutím.